Thanksgiving Preschool Coloring Contest

By Director

Download the coloring sheets and official rules by clicking here.

Rules:

ð        Must be ages 3-5 to enter and live in Charlevoix, Emmet or northern Antrim counties.

ð        One entry per child and the may choose one of the 3 coloring sheets – not all three.

ð        More than one child per household is allowed with separate entries.

ð        Drawings submitted will not be returned.

ð        Coloring sheets must be turned into Glen’s of Boyne City, Charlevoix, East Jordan or Central Food’s in Central Lake November 15, 2010 at noon.

ð        Complete entry form must be filled out for child and family to be eligible for the prizes.

ð        One winner from each store will be chosen based on creativity.

Four winners will be selected; Top two winners will receive a new winter coat and boots donated by GRS Transportation of Charlevoix and Georgia House Assisted Living Facility of Charlevoix. Second Place winner will receive a Turkey Dinner valued at $50 donated by Glens in Charlevoix, and the third winner will receive a $25 Spartan Store gift card donated by Glen’s of East Jordan.

Winners will be chosen on November 16, 2010 and each winner will be contacted by November 17, 2010.

  • Teen Reader's Theatre Group
    This group is designed for grades 9 & up (Though, this is very flexible). Reader's Theatre is a legitimate form of drama with actors using their voices and upper bodies to convey various roles in a script through reading to an audience. It differs from a play in that parts or roles are read rather than memorized. Actors usually stand behind lecterns […]

About

Funded with a grant from the Early Childhood Investment Corporation of the State of Michigan and the Kellogg Foundation, our project began in April of 2006. The goal of the project is to form multiple collaborative bodies in the state to begin development of a comprehensive system of early childhood care and education for 0-5 year olds and their families. This system is similar to the Smart Start system of North Carolina and the state of Michigan is receiving technical assistance in our efforts from the state of North Carolina.
